As for Beetle figures, you can't compare world wide production figures to real sales figures, in europe, Ford were the new 'Big Boys', Escorts, Cortina's, Grandada's were killing the UK VW sales........Im old enough to remember VW cutting prices in 72 and introducing all manor of 'tarted up' beetle models to try pick up UK sales......Jeans Beetle, GT Beetle, Sun Bug......the list goes on......
